I have stayed at this hotel many times when it was a Le Meridian (Starwood) hotel and prefer it over the Nikko just across the tracks. The staff is very welcoming and professional and take great effort to insure your comfort. Very easy access to the Big Sight and Tokyo by rail. I'd highly recommend for any business traveler. I really enjoyed the Grand Pacific. It was close enough to Tokyo (15 minute monorail ride) but outside of the hustle and bustle. It was located next to AquaCity in Daiba and at AquaCity one could find more than 30 dining options which was always nice after a long day exploring Tokyo.
